BACKGROUND: Coronary artery perforations are one of the most feared, rare, and catastrophic complication of percutaneous coronary intervention. Despite the remarkable increase in coronary angiography and percutaneous coronary intervention, there is no large database that collects coronary artery perforation for the Turkish population. Our study aimed to report our experience over a 10-year period for clinical and angiographic characteristics, management strategies, and outcomes of coronary artery perforation during the percutaneous coronary intervention at different cardiology departments in Turkey. METHODS: The study data came from a retrospective analysis of 48 360 percutaneous coronary intervention procedures between January 2010 and June 2020. A total of 110 cases who had coronary artery perforation during the percutaneous coronary intervention were found by angiographic review. Analysis has been performed for the basic clinical, angiographic, procedural characteristics, the management of coronary artery perforation, and outcome of all patients. RESULTS: The coronary artery perforation rate was 0.22%. Out of 110 patients with coronary artery perforation, 66 patients showed indications for percutaneous coronary intervention with acute coronary syndrome and 44 patients with stable angina pectoris. The most common lesion type and perforated artery were type C (34.5%) and left anterior descending (41.8%), respectively. The most observed coronary artery perforation according to Ellis classification was type III (37.2%). Almost 52.7% of patients have a covered stent implanted in the perforated artery. The all-cause mortality rate of coronary artery perforation patients in the hospital was 18.1%. CONCLUSION: The observed rate of coronary artery perforation in our study is consistent with the studies in this literature. However, the mortality rates related to coronary artery perforation are higher than in other studies in this literature. Especially, the in-hospital mortality rate was higher in type II and type III groups due to perforation and its complications. Nevertheless, percutaneous coronary intervention should be done in selected patients despite catastrophic complications.

AIMS: The frontal QRS-T (fQRS) angle has been investigated in the general population, including healthy people and patients with heart failure. The fQRS angle can predict mortality due to myocarditis, ischaemic and non-ischaemic cardiomyopathies, idiopathic dilated cardiomyopathy, and chronic heart failure in the general population. Moreover, no studies to date have investigated fQRS angle in coronavirus disease 2019 (COVID-19) patients. Thus, the purpose of this retrospective multicentre study was to evaluate the fQRS angle of COVID-19 patients to predict in-hospital mortality and the need for mechanical ventilation. METHODS AND RESULTS: An electrocardiogram was performed for 327 COVID-19 patients during admission, and the fQRS angle was calculated. Mechanical ventilation was needed in 119 patients; of them, 110 died in the hospital. The patients were divided into two groups according to an fQRs angle >90° versus an fQRS angle ≤90°. The percentages of mortality and the need for mechanical ventilation according to fQRS angle were 67.8% and 66.1%, respectively, in the fQRs >90° group and 26.1% and 29.9% in the fQRS ≤90°group. Heart rate, oxygen saturation, fQRS angle, estimated glomerular filtration rate, and C-reactive protein level were predictors of mortality on the multivariable analysis. The mortality risk increased 2.9-fold on the univariate analysis and 1.6-fold on the multivariate analysis for the fQRS >90° patient group versus the fQRS ≤90° group. CONCLUSION: In conclusion, a wide fQRS angle >90° was a predictor of in-hospital mortality and associated with the need for mechanical ventilation among COVID-19 patients.

BACKGROUND: Myocardial bridge (MB) is generally considered as a benign condition, but it may trigger atherosclerosis, especially in the adjacent proximal coronary artery segment. In this study, we aimed to investigate whether the Framingham risk score (FRS) or atherogenic indices are risk factors for coronary atherosclerosis in patients with MB in the left anterior descending coronary artery (LAD). METHODS: We performed a retrospective study evaluating 155 patients who have MB in LAD. The patients were evaluated in two groups according to the presence of atherosclerosis (74 patients in atherosclerotic group vs. 81 patients in non-atherosclerotic group). Baseline characteristics, FRS and atherogenic indices were reviewed between groups. Significant independent risk factors for coronary atherosclerosis were investigated by logistic regression analysis. RESULTS: Patients in atherosclerotic group were significantly older (58.15 ± 10.04 vs. 50.22 ± 9.27 years, p < .001) and 74.3% of the patients were male. While the mean FRS in the atherosclerotic group was 21.20 ± 8.81, it was 12.79 ± 8.61 in the non-atherosclerotic group (p < .001). Among the atherogenic indices, only LDL-c/HDL-c ratio was significantly higher in the atherosclerotic group (3.49 ± 1.2 vs. 3.11 ± 0.98, p:.033). Multivariable analysis showed that age (OR: 1.08, 95% CI 1.03-1.13, p < .001) and FRS (OR: 1.06, 95% CI 1.01-1.11, p:.012) were independently associated with the presence of atherosclerotic lesion. CONCLUSIONS: FRS is an easily applicable predictor in clinical practice that indicates the presence of coronary atherosclerosis in patients with MB in LAD.

OBJECTIVES: The aim of this study was to investigate the relationship between the C-reactive protein/albumin ratio and the prognosis of hypertensive COVID-19 patients. METHODS: It was designed as a single center retrospective study. PCR positive COVID-19 patients who were followed up in the intensive care unit (ICU) and received antihypertensive treatment were included in the study. The patients were divided into two groups as survivor and non-survivor. C-reactive protein/albumin (CAR) ratios of the patients were compared. The cut-off value was determined as a mortality predictor. The effect of CAR on mortality was evaluated using Logistic Regression analysis. RESULTS: 281 patients were included in the study. Groups consisted of 135 (non-survivor) and 146 (survivor) patients. CAR was significantly higher in the non-survivor group (p<0.001). The area under the ROC curve for CAR for mortality was 0.807, with sensitivity of 0.71 and specificity of 0.71. The cut-off value for CAR was calculated as 56.62. In logistic regression analysis, CAR increases mortality 4.9 times compared to the cut-off value. CONCLUSION: CAR is a powerful and independent prognostic marker for predicting mortality and disease progression in hypertensive COVID-19 patients.

In this study, we investigated whether the CHA2DS2-VASc score could be used to estimate the need for hospitalization in the intensive care unit (ICU), the length of stay in the ICU, and mortality in patients with COVID-19. Patients admitted to Merkezefendi State Hospital because of COVID-19 diagnosis confirmed by RNA detection of virus by using polymerase chain reaction between March 24, 2020 and July 6, 2020, were screened retrospectively. The CHA2DS2-VASc and modified CHA2DS2-VASc score of all patients was calculated. Also, we received all patients' complete biochemical markers including D-dimer, Troponin I, and c-reactive protein on admission. We enrolled 1000 patients; 791 were admitted to the general medical service and 209 to the ICU; 82 of these 209 patients died. The ROC curves of the CHA2DS2-VASc and M-CHA2DS2-VASc scores were analyzed. The cut-off values of these scores for predicting mortality were ≥ 3 (2 or under and 3). The CHA2DS2-VASc and M-CHA2DS2-VASc scores had an area under the curve value of 0.89 on the ROC. The sensitivity and specificity of the CHA2DS2-VASc scores were 81.7% and 83.8%, respectively; the sensitivity and specificity of the M-CHA2DS2-VASc scores were 85.3% and 84.1%, respectively. Multivariate logistic regression analysis showed that CHA2DS2-VASc, Troponin I, D-Dimer, and CRP were independent predictors of mortality in COVID-19 patients. Using a simple and easily available scoring system, CHA2DS2-VASc and M-CHA2DS2-VASc scores can be assessed in patients diagnosed with COVID-19. These scores can predict mortality and the need for ICU hospitalization in these patients.

AIM: This study was designed to assess the effect of patient education on the knowledge of safety and awareness about living with cardiac implantable electronic devices (CIEDs) within the context of phase I cardiac rehabilitation. METHODS: The study was conducted with 28 newly implanted CIED patients who were included in "education group (EG)". Patients were questioned with a survey about living with CIEDs and electromagnetic interference (EMI) before and 1 month after an extensive constructed interview. Ninety-three patients who had been living with CIEDs were included in the "without education group (woEG)". RESULTS: Patients in EG had improved awareness on topics related to physical and daily life activities including work, driving, sports and sexual activities, EMI of household items, harmful equipment, and some of the medical devices in the hospital setting (p<0.05). Patients in EG gave significantly different percent of correct answers for doing exercise or sports, using the arm on the side of CIEDs, EMI of some of the household appliances, medical devices, and all of the harmful equipment compared to woEG (p<0.05). CONCLUSION: It was demonstrated that a constructed education interview on safety of CIEDs and living with these devices within the context of phase I cardiac rehabilitation is important for improving the awareness of patients significantly. Thus, patients might achieve a faster adaptation to daily life and decrease disinformation and misperceptions and thus promote the quality of life after the device implantation.

OBJECTIVE: The present study compared heart rate variability (HRV) parameters in patients with coronary artery ectasia (CAE) and coronary artery disease (CAD). METHODS: The study population consisted of 60 consecutive patients with CAE (14 women; mean age 51.63±7.44 years), 60 consecutive patients with CA (15 women; mean age 53.67±9.31 years), and 59 healthy individuals (13 women; mean age 52.85±8.19 years). Electrocardiograms, 24-hour Holter analyses, and routine biochemical tests were performed, and clinical characteristics were evaluated. Coronary angiography images were analyzed. Time-domain HRV parameters, including the standard deviation (SD) of normal-to-normal intervals (SDNN) and the root mean square of difference in successive normal-to-normal intervals (RMSSD) were evaluated, as were frequency-domain HRV parameters including low-frequency (LF), very low-frequency (VLF), high-frequency (HF), the proportion derived by dividing low- and high-frequency (LF/HF), and total power (TP). RESULTS: SDNN was lower in both the CAE and CAD groups, compared to the healthy group (140.85±44.21, 96.51±31.28, and 181.05±48.67, respectively). A significant difference in RMSSD values among the groups was determined (p=0.004). Significantly decreased VLF and HF values were found in the CAE group, compared with the healthy group (VLF p<0.001; HF, p=0.007). TP, VLF, and HF values were significantly lower (p<0.001, p<0.001, and p<0.001, respectively), but LF and LF/HF values were significantly higher (p<0.001 for both) in the CAD group than in the healthy group. TP values were significantly higher (p<0.001), and LF and LF/HF values were lower in the CAE group, compared with the CAD group (p<0.001 for both). CONCLUSION: A decrease in vagal modulation or an increase in sympathetic activity of cardiac function, assessed by HRV analysis, is worse in patients with CAD than in patients with CAE.

OBJECTIVE: Atrial functions are relatively suppressed in heart failure (HF). We aimed to investigate the associations of intra- and inter-atrial electromechanical conduction delay (EMCD) with functional class and mortality over a 12-month follow-up period. METHODS: The prospective study included 65 patients with systolic HF and 65 healthy subjects with normal sinus rhythm. Left ventricular (LV) systolic functions and left atrial (LA) dimensions and volumes were evaluated by transthoracic echocardiography. Tissue Doppler imaging (TDI) signals at the lateral border of the mitral annulus (lateral PA'), septal mitral annulus (septal PA'), and tricuspid annulus (tricuspid PA') were measured. Intra- and inter-atrial EMCD were calculated. RESULTS: Mitral inflow velocities were studied using pulsed-wave Doppler after placing the sample volume at the leaflets' tips. The peak early (E wave) and late (A wave) velocities were measured. The septal annular E/E' ratio was relatively higher and lateral, septal, and right ventricular S, E', and A' waves were significantly lower in the HF group than in the control group (12.49±6.03 - 7.16±1.75, pE/E' <0.0001). Intra-atrial EMCD was detected as 117.5 ms and inter-atrial EMCD as 127.5 ms in patients with prolonged atrial EMCD. A significant increase was found in prolonged intraand inter-atrial EMCD according to functional capacity increase (p=0.012 and p=0.031, respectively). The incidence of mortality was significantly higher in patients with prolonged atrial EMCD (p=0.025), and 5 patients in the HF group died during the study over the 12-month follow-up period. CONCLUSIONS: In this study, we found a relationship between prolonged atrial conduction time and increased functional class and mortality in patients with systolic HF.

Transcatheter aortic valve implantation is preferred to treat high surgical risk patients with severe aort stenosis. Wrapping of a pig tail catheter with device struts during transcatheter aortic valve implantation is a very rare complication. In this report, we present the images and videos of an attempt of retrieval of an aortic valve wrapped with pig tail catheter during transcatheter aortic valve implantation in a 71-year-old man.

BACKGROUND: Heart rate (HR) reduction is associated with improved outcomes in patients with heart failure (HF) and biomarkers can be a valuable diagnostic tool in HF management. The primary aim of our study was to evaluate the short-term (6 months) effect of ivabradine on N-terminal pro B-type natriuretic peptide (NT-proBNP), CA-125, and cystatin-C values in systolic HF outpatients, and secondary aim was to determine the relationship between baseline HR and the NT-proBNP, CA-125, cystatin-C, and clinical status variation with ivabradine therapy. METHODS: Ninety-eight patients (mean age: 65.81 ± 10.20 years; 33 men), left ventricular ejection fraction < 35% with Simpson method, New York Heart Association (NYHA) class II-III, sinus rhythm and resting HR > 70/min, optimally treated before the study were included. Among them, two matched groups were formed: the ivabradine group and the control group. Patients received ivabradine with an average (range of 10-15) mg/day during 6 months of follow-up. Blood samples for NT-proBNP, CA-125, and cystatin-C were taken at baseline and at the end of a 6-month follow-up in both groups. RESULTS: There was a significant decrease in NYHA class in the ivabradine group (2.67 ± ± 0.47 vs. 1.85 ± 0.61, p < 0.001). When ivabradine and control groups were compared, a significant difference was also found in NHYA class 6 months later (p = 0.013). A significant decrease was found in HR in the ivabradine and control groups (84.10 ± 8.76 vs. 68.36 ± ± 8.32 bpm, p = 0.001; 84.51 ± 10 vs. 80.40 ± 8.3 bpm, p = 0.001). When both groups were compared, a significant difference was also found in HR after 6 months (p = 0.001). A significant decrease was found in cystatin-C (2.10 ± 0.73 vs. 1.50 ± 0.44 mg/L, p < 0.001), CA-125 (30.09 ± 21.08 vs. 13.22 ± 8.51 U/mL, p < 0.001), and NT-proBNP (1,353.02 ± 1,453.77 vs. 717.81 ± 834.76 pg/mL, p < 0.001) in the ivabradine group. When ivabradine and control groups were compared after 6 months, a significant decrease was found in all HF parameters (respectively; cystatin-C: p = 0.001, CA-125: p = 0.001, NT-proBNP: p = 0.001). Creatinine level was significantly decreased and glomerular filtration rate (GFR) was significantly increased in the ivabradine group (1.02 ± 0.26 vs. 0.86 ± 0.17, creatinine: p = 0.001; 79.26 ± 18.58 vs. 92.48 ± 19.88, GFR: p = 0.001). There was no significant correlation between NYHA classes (before and after ivabradine therapy) and biochemical markers, or HR. CONCLUSIONS: In the outpatients with systolic HF, persistent resting HF > 70/min with optimal medical therapy, the NT-proBNP, CA-125, and cystatin-C reductions were obtained with ivabradine treatment. Measurement of NT-proBNP, CA-125, and cystatin-C may prove to be useful in biomarker panels evaluating ivabradine therapy response in HF patients.

BACKGROUND: Obesity alters endocrine and metabolic functions of adipose tissue and has been recognized as a chronic inflammatory disease, which in turn may contribute to the development of insulin resistance, type 2 diabetes, obesity-associated vasculopathy and cardiovascular disease. The pathogenesis of obesity involves many regulatory pathways including transcriptional regulatory networks, including microRNAs. METHODS: A total of 83 patients were included in the study. Patients were recruited from a cardiology outpatient clinic and were allocated into 3 age- and sex-matched groups according to their body mass index. Group 1 included 23 morbidly obese, group 2 30 obese, and group 3 30 normal or overweight subjects. RESULTS: In our study, we showed that miR-143 and miR-223 levels were significantly lower in groups 1 and 2 than the control group (normal BMI or overweight). CONCLUSIONS: Obesity leads to alterations in miRNA expressions and miRNA-143 and -223s can be used as biomarkers for the metabolic changes in obesity.

Coronary artery fistulas are the second most frequently seen coronary anomaly following abnormalities of coronary artery origin and distribution. A coronary fistula is defined as a direct communication between a coronary artery and any cardiac chamber or vessel. Treatment options include percutaneous embolization and surgical intervention. Herein, we present a case of a giant coronary artery fistula and right atrial tachycardia that was induced during a diagnostic electrophysiologic study but was not inducible after the successful treatment of the fistula. This is the first case indicating this association.
